There are lots of upgrades that people make to their MP3 players from additional storage to skins and better earphones. A company called Stafa has introduced a new set of in-ear earphones called Audeo earphones. The device is designed to be comfortable for hours of use and offer superb sound quality.
The earphones are designed to work well for music, movies, and gaming. They are designed with different size audio filters to closely match the natural response of a person's ear. The devices will work with all standard MP3 players including the iPhone. Any device that works with a 3.5mm jack can use the Audeo earphones. Audeo earphones with a mic for the iPhone sell for $159 and without retail for $139.
"Phonak has decades of experience with the anatomy of the human ear," said Valentin Chapero, CEO Phonak. "With Audéo earphones, we're applying that knowledge to offer a stylish solution for music-loving consumers seeking a high-quality, ultra-comfortable listening experience."
